Role : Data Scientist with Pharmaceutical or Healthcare Domain ExperienceJob Description : We are seeking a highly skilled professional to join our Real World Data (RWD) team. This role focuses on building scalable, reproducible data pipelines and disease-specific datasets that power clinical research, health economics, and outcomes studies. You will collaborate closely with subject matter experts (SMEs), clinicians, and data engineers to translate protocol-level specifications into computable datasets that support oncology and specialty disease research.Key Responsibilities : - Clinical rule implementation : Translate SME-designed clinical rules into scalable, reproducible data pipelines operating against the central data lake.- Structured and unstructured data integration : Engineer patient-level features using medical and pharmacy claims, lab results, and NLP-derived outputs.- Disease-specific dataset development : Build and maintain datasets covering cohort construction, index dating, treatment sequencing, and clinical event labeling.- Line of therapy algorithms : Develop and apply algorithms that handle real-world complexity including combination regimens, gaps, dose modifications, and off-label use.- NLP signal integration : Incorporate diagnosis mentions, staging, biomarker results, and progression language alongside structured claims to enrich dataset completeness.- Data quality assurance : Produce data quality reports and conduct sample-level audits to validate clinical logic against source data.- Collaborative refinement : Work iteratively with SMEs to surface anomalies, identify rule gaps, and refine logic collaboratively.Required : - 4+ years of experience in data science, biostatistics, or health data engineering within life sciences.- Proficiency in SQL and Python (or R) for large-scale healthcare data manipulation.- Direct experience with claims data, EMR data, or both in an RWD or HEOR setting.- Familiarity with NLP outputs and integrating unstructured signals into structured datasets.- Experience implementing clinical event algorithms from protocol-level specifications.Preferred : - Experience with cloud data lakes or warehouses (Snowflake, Redshift, Databricks).- Familiarity with OMOP CDM or other clinical data models.- Background in oncology datasets or specialty disease datasets.- Comfort working in a pod model with close clinical collaboration.Disease Areas : - Initial pod coverage will include Breast Cancer, Gastric Cancer, and Multiple Sclerosis, with additional indications prioritized based on client demand. Team members will develop deep expertise in anchor indications while expanding breadth across the portfolio.
